Journal of Experimental and Theoretical Physics
Description
The Journal of Experimental and Theoretical Physics is published in English translation simultaneously with its original Russian edition. This influential physics research journal emphasizes fundamental theoretical and experimental research in all fields of physics, from solid state to elementary particles and cosmology. Coverage extends to all areas of basic and applied physics, presenting experimental and theoretical articles devoted to the main topics of fundamental physics: gravitation; nucleic particles; atoms, spectra and radiation; plasma; liquids; solids (including superconductors, properties of surfaces, etc.); and nonlinear physics.
